Oscars In Quesada For Breakfast – Good Value.

HeyDaveHere, March 8, 2026March 8, 2026

Sunday saw us out and about collecting some chilli plants and honey, so as we were in Quesada, we decided to grab breakfast, well brunch really as it was past 11am. Now, we chose Oscars because we see them getting recommended often, both for breakfasts and also for Sunday lunch, when people ask on social media.

Actually, we visited here a long time ago and it wasn’t good service, but we decided to give them another try and I’m glad we did. We know that restaurants and bars can sometimes have an “off-day”, which is why we will often try a place for a second attempt. However, if they screw up the second visit, that’s them on the places not to bother with list.

Sunday was overcast, not overly warm and as such, the high street was fairly quiet, meaning we got a parking space.

What We Had

We both ordered a tea to drink, then browsed the menu and then we both decided that we’d have a breakfast, so ordered the large breakfast each. I said to Soph, I’d help her out with hers, if she struggled to eat it all.

The tea was served in a mug, so a good sized drink, the drinks also came with a wonderful little cookie biscuit.

Our breakfasts were very filling so be warned if you pick the large breakfast! The bacon was really nice and tasty. The eggs were lovely and white and clearly cooked in clean oil; there’s nothing more off putting than food being served that looks ‘dirty’ around the edges.

What We Liked

Good honest food, friendly welcoming service and the staff were busy, but service was superb throughout. What we had to eat and drink was really good value for money!

There is seating both inside and out doors, although it’s out of season, we managed to park close by too.

What Could Be Improved

Actually, nothing about our visit raised any issues at all. It’s a clearly popular place and that’s good enough really.

How Much Did It Cost

All in the bill was 16€, which was for two large breakfasts including the drinks.

If you’re wanting a decent, fill you up full English breakfast, this hit the mark for us, at a really good price.

Would We Return To Oscars

The food that was coming out on Sunday all looked nice, while we were there. Also, on their Facebook page the photos of desserts and Sunday lunches, both looked really good too. So, yes we will return probably to try their Sunday lunch next time, but they do a Friday offer with happy hour and tapas promotions, so that might be another option.

I’m glad we revisited and even more so as it was a nice breakfast.

How To Get To Oscars

If you’re coming in from the AP7, come off the roundabout and drive up through the arches, past the petrol station, and on the left as you go up the hill, about 50 metres from the Sabadell bank.
Their actual address is Av. De Las Naciones 1C Local 8, Ciudad Quesada, Spain, 03170, if you’re needing to use Satnav.
